Dhoni Stays Finisher, CSK Requires Batting Boost

Former Australia captain Michael Clarke has weighed in on the ongoing debate surrounding MS Dhoni’s batting position within the Chennai Super Kings (CSK) line-up, staunchly advocating for the veteran cricketer to retain his role as the team’s finisher. Clarke’s assertion follows a flurry of opinions from fans and cricket pundits, spurred by Dhoni’s electrifying performance against the Delhi Capitals in Vizag, where he smashed an unbeaten 37 runs off just 16 deliveries.

In a panel discussion aired on Star Sports in anticipation of the CSK versus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) showdown, Clarke reiterated his belief in Dhoni’s unparalleled proficiency in finishing matches. He emphasized the significance of Dhoni’s role as a finisher, asserting that his unmatched ability to navigate pressure situations and close games decisively remains pivotal to CSK’s fortunes.

Contrary to suggestions for Dhoni to ascend the batting order, Clarke staunchly defended Dhoni’s current position, highlighting the need for continuity and balance in the team’s lineup. He stressed that Dhoni’s mastery as a finisher has been honed over years of experience, making him an indispensable asset in the lower-middle order.

Supporting Clarke’s viewpoint, former cricketer-turned-commentator Sanjay Manjrekar echoed the sentiment, underscoring Dhoni’s unique skill set and his knack for delivering impactful performances within limited deliveries. Manjrekar cautioned against disrupting the team’s established batting order, asserting that Dhoni’s role as a finisher ensures maximum effectiveness and efficiency in run-chases. Reflecting on Dhoni’s legacy and influence, Clarke emphasized the importance of fostering confidence among the players preceding Dhoni in the batting order. He posited that Dhoni’s presence should inspire aggressive intent from the top order, allowing them to play freely with the assurance of Dhoni’s adeptness awaiting them.

As CSK endeavors to bounce back from consecutive defeats in the ongoing IPL 2024 season, the team’s reliance on Dhoni’s match-winning abilities becomes increasingly pronounced. With the impending challenge against KKR on the horizon, CSK aims to recalibrate their campaign, drawing upon the familiarity and comfort of their home ground, the iconic M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ai.

In essence, Michael Clarke’s unwavering support for MS Dhoni’s role as a finisher underscores the veteran’s enduring value to the CSK franchise. As the IPL season unfolds, CSK’s fortunes hinge not only on Dhoni’s continued brilliance but also on the emergence of young talents poised to complement his match-winning contributions in the team’s batting lineup.
